Featuring the recipes and memories of Alice B. Toklas?a prominent American expat who lived in France and was Gertrude Stein?s lover?The Alice B. Toklas Cook Book is a precursor to the classic works of famed French chefs Julia Child and M. F. K. Fisher , and stands alongside Stein?s The Autobiography of Alice B. Toklas as a celebration of the fascinating life and times of the woman James Beard called, ?one of the really great cooks of all time.?
